Understanding Glass Setting Materials: Properties and Types

auto technician working

Glass setting materials play a crucial role in the automotive industry, especially when it comes to custom and performance vehicles. These materials are responsible for ensuring that glass panels are securely attached to vehicle bodies, enhancing both safety and aesthetic appeal. Understanding the properties and types of glass setting materials is essential for collision repair centers and vehicle body shops looking to offer top-notch services.

The market offers a range of options, from traditional cements to modern adhesives designed specifically for automotive applications. Each type has unique characteristics; some are known for their high bond strength, ideal for areas requiring structural integrity, while others provide excellent weather resistance, crucial for exterior glass installations. In light of this diversity, car scratch repair experts can tailor their choices to specific vehicle needs, ensuring long-lasting and reliable results that meet the high standards of today’s automotive landscape.
